Don’t you dare send the “thumbs up” emoji!
Gen Z finds the thumbs up emoji passive aggressive and even confrontational. One Gen Z person interviewed even called that emoji “hurtful”.
The thumbs up emoji confuses some people. ‘Do you mean yes I will do something, okay I agree or is it just confirmation that you received the message?”
Some business consultants believe you should alwasys choose words over symbols in workplace correspondence.

Here are emojis that make you look old
1 – Thumbs up – 24%
2 – Red love heart – 22%
3 – OK hand – 20%
4 – Tick – 17%
5 – Poo – 17%
6 – Loudly crying face – 16%
7 – Monkey eye cover – 15%
8 – Clapping hands – 10%
9 – Lipstick kiss mark – 10%
10 – Grimacing face – 9%
